The training offered through Starbucks’ Farmer Support Centers focuses on agronomic training and business management skills, which are essential for coffee farmers to enhance their crop production and manage their businesses effectively. Agronomic training provides farmers with knowledge about best farming practices, improving quality and yield, and fostering sustainable farming techniques. Business management skills are equally important as they help farmers understand how to operate their businesses more efficiently, manage finances, and navigate the market effectively.

The emphasis on these areas reflects Starbucks’ commitment to ethical sourcing by supporting farmers not just in producing high-quality coffee, but also in ensuring their economic viability and sustainability. This support ultimately contributes to a more resilient supply chain and helps foster strong relationships between Starbucks and the farmers from whom they source their coffee.
